31/01/2002 (Agence Europe) - At the end of Thursday afternoon, the European Commission is expected to issue its ruling on the planned acquisition of Compaq Computer by Hewlett-Packard. The Wall Street Journal reported on Thursday that close sources suggested the deal would probably be given an unconditional go-ahead by the Commission. The deal is worth some $22.3 billion and would be the biggest merger ever in the IT business.
